David Wilder formally of the Chi White Sox was formally charged with taking kickbacks from young prospects. If you don’t know the story then here’s the deal:
David was the Senior Director of Player Personnel for the White Sox who apparently according to the Chicago Tribune
“The indictment alleged that Wilder and two former Sox scouts, Jorge Oquendo Rivera and Victor Mateo, fraudulently inflated the signing bonuses of Latin American prospects and then had the players kick back the extra money to them over the more than three-year scheme. In all, they pocketed about $400,000 intended for 23 prospects, authorities said.”
